Output 1712d5c57ec951ec39742b4507a30336fb332f1cbec8918bdcc13bc6a1694178:1

value
18677316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5eac8626d20edff54450f61deb4ec634676bbe OP_EQUAL
address
3HDrDDPKBcV24C9MrCDe4XSfea95fQ6Z4B
transaction
1712d5c57ec951ec39742b4507a30336fb332f1cbec8918bdcc13bc6a1694178
spent
true